A Si-APD array detector for nuclear resonant scattering using synchrotron X-rays and its fast-pulse processing

✍ Scribed by S. Kishimoto; T. Taniguchi; M. Tanaka; T. Mitsui; M. Seto

✦ Synopsis


An 8 Â 2 array of silicon avalanche photodiode (Si-APD) was developed as an X-ray detector for the M össbauer micro-spectroscopy on Fe-57 (nuclear resonant energy: 14.4 keV; half-life: 98 ns) using synchrotron X-rays. The time resolution DT (FWHM) of the Si-APD array detector was 0.3 ns in the forward scattering experiments. Ultra-fast frontend circuits have been provided for the Si-APD array with the pixilated position sensitivity. A fast amplifier was first developed using hybrid ICs. Its charge sensitivity was 4 V/pC and the pulse width was 2.3 ns (FWHM).
